AN OVERSIZED CELEBRATION OF THE GOLDEN AVENGER'S 650th ISSUE!
•  It's IRON MAN DAY in New York City, but not everyone is ready to celebrate the ongoing legacy of Tony Stark - least of all him. But a sudden crisis will once again test Tony's heroism and challenge his commitment to the role he has assumed for himself. Must there be an Iron Man?
•  Christopher Cantwell concludes his thought-provoking and powerful run as writer, as illustrated by Angel Unzueta.
